Bourton Half
The Bourton Half is a single-lap Half-marathon held on Sunday 27 September 2026. The course passes through the villages of Farmington, Clapton and Sherborne, with race headquarters, start and finish located at Greystones Farm in Bourton-on-the-Water.
The event is part of the 2026 Gloucestershire AAA road race series and will incorporate the Gloucestershire Half Marathon Championships; championship eligibility rules apply. All finishers of the Bourton Half will be offered a priority entry to the Highbridge Jewellers’ Bourton 10k in 2027 ahead of general entry.
Online entry prices are shown separately for affiliated and unaffiliated runners: affiliated entries cost £21.00 plus a £1.11 booking fee; unaffiliated entries cost £23.00 plus a £1.21 booking fee. Entries are open and will close at 5pm on Sunday 20 September 2026. Entries on the day will be accepted subject to availability at a slightly higher price.
The event organiser distinguishes affiliated and unaffiliated tickets. An affiliated ticket is for runners affiliated to one of the UK athletics affiliated bodies; an unaffiliated ticket is for runners not affiliated to those bodies.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
